Tom Hiatt can truly be called a “Son of the West” because Arizona, Texas, California, Alaska, and Kansas have all been called “home.” The magnificent landscapes and the people who live in them fill the stories in the ballads Tom writes and sings: working cowboys, historic legendary characters, changes in the modern West, and more.
Tom’s warm, emotion filled voice has enthralled people from Montana to Arizona, from the Pacific to the Atlantic, and all areas in between. He has appeared with other popular cowboy singers and poets such as Ian Tyson, Chris LeDoux, Waddie Mitchell, The Sons of the San Joaquin, Sourdough Slim, and Don Edwards, at many cowboy poetry and music festivals throughout the country. More noteworthy appearances include, the Autry National Center, the Kamloops Cowboy Festival, the Carson City Rendezvous, the Tombstone Western Music Festival, the Lone Pine Museum of Western Film History, and the Western Music Association’s Showcase and Awards Show.
Voted one of the “Top 5” acts in western music, Tom was nominated for Entertainer of the Year, Male Performer of the Year, and Songwriter of the Year by the WMA. His original song “Bronc to Breakfast” won the Academy of Western Artists “Will Rogers Cowboy Award” for Best Western Song of 2011 and he was nominated for Best Western Male Artist for 2015 by the AWA.
